Filmmaker Donna McRae (Johnny Ghost) has commenced principal photography on her next feature film, Lost Gully Road, which has been filming in Melbourne since December 5. Here’s the synopsis:
Lost Gully Road tells the story of Lucy, who goes to a secluded cottage to wait for her sister. But there are other things that get in her way.
That’s pretty light on detail. What we can say at this point is that Lost Gully Road has assembled a decent cast, including Adele Perovic (The Code), Eloise Mignon (The Cherry Orchard), John Brumpton (Pawno), and Jane Clifton.
Shedding a little more light, McRae said, “I’m very excited to be making this new film. It’s a minimal ghost story that, at its core, is a comment on domestic violence. The cast is wonderful and I am thrilled to be working with my regular collaborators once again.”
Expect Lost Gully Road on the festival circuit in 2017.
